<title>ARM: 5841/1: a driver for on-chip ETM and ETB</title>
<updated>2009-12-02T10:25:22+00:00</updated>
<author>
<name>Alexander Shishkin</name>
<email>virtuoso@slind.org</email>
</author>
<published>2009-12-01T13:00:51+00:00</published>
<link rel='alternate' type='text/html' href='https://git.tavy.me/linux-stable.git/commit/?id=c5d6c7708c3e58015b2e4e13e6cea02c8567a94e'/>
<id>c5d6c7708c3e58015b2e4e13e6cea02c8567a94e</id>
<content type='text'>
This driver implements support for on-chip Embedded Tracing Macrocell and
Embedded Trace Buffer. It allows to trigger tracing of kernel execution flow
and exporting trace output to userspace via character device and a sysrq
combo.

Trace output can then be decoded by a fairly simple open source tool [1]
which is already sufficient to get the idea of what the kernel is doing.

<title>iop: clockevent support</title>
<updated>2009-10-29T18:46:54+00:00</updated>
<author>
<name>Mikael Pettersson</name>
<email>mikpe@it.uu.se</email>
</author>
<published>2009-10-29T18:46:54+00:00</published>
<link rel='alternate' type='text/html' href='https://git.tavy.me/linux-stable.git/commit/?id=469d30448dad13600cdd246024f9db8e80614c45'/>
<id>469d30448dad13600cdd246024f9db8e80614c45</id>
<content type='text'>
This updates the IOP platform to expose the interrupting
timer 0 as a clockevent object. The timer interrupt handler
is changed to call the clockevent -&gt;event_handler() instead
of timer_tick(), and -&gt;set_next_event() and -&gt;set_mode()
operations are added to allow the mode of the timer to be
updated (required for ONESHOT/NOHZ mode).

Timer 0 must now be properly initialised, which requires
a new write_tcr0() function from the mach-specific code.

The mode of timer 0 must be read at the start of -&gt;set_mode(),
which requires a new read_tmr0() function from the mach-
specific code.

Initial setup of timer 0 is also rewritten to be more robust.

Tested on n2100, compile-tested for all plat-iop machines.

<title>iop: clocksource support</title>
<updated>2009-10-29T18:46:54+00:00</updated>
<author>
<name>Mikael Pettersson</name>
<email>mikpe@it.uu.se</email>
</author>
<published>2009-10-29T18:46:54+00:00</published>
<link rel='alternate' type='text/html' href='https://git.tavy.me/linux-stable.git/commit/?id=a91549a8f27e63e0e537fe1c20d4845581de894f'/>
<id>a91549a8f27e63e0e537fe1c20d4845581de894f</id>
<content type='text'>
This updates the IOP platform to expose the free-running
timer 1 as a clocksource object. This timer is now also
properly initialised, which requires a new write_tcr1()
function from the mach-specific code. Apart from the
explicit initialisation, there is no functional change
in how timer 1 is programmed.

Tested on n2100, compile-tested for all plat-iop machines.
